      Meaning of the first name
      Cassius

      Origin 
      Latin

      Meaning 
      Vain

      Variations 
      Cashius, Caelius, Cassian

      The name Cassius finds its origins in Latin and carries a profound meaning: Vain. This ancient name has traversed through time, making appearances in various historical contexts and finding relevance in modern-day usage.

      In history, the name Cassius gained prominence through its association with Gaius Cassius Longinus, a Roman senator and one of the conspirators in the assassination of Julius Caesar in 44 BCE. The name became synonymous with rebellion and dissent against authority, as Cassius played a pivotal role in the plot to overthrow the Roman dictator. Despite his eventual defeat, the name Cassius echoed throughout the annals of history as a symbol of resistance and individualism.

      In the modern era, the name Cassius continues to be embraced by parents seeking a unique and powerful name for their children. Its Latin origin and meaning contribute to its appeal, as it carries a sense of strength and confidence. The name has found usage across different cultures and regions, often symbolizing a spirit of rebellion and independence. Whether in literature, popular culture, or everyday life, the name Cassius remains an enduring choice that harkens back to its historical significance while resonating with contemporary sensibilities.
